Where is USS Abraham Lincoln now?

ALBAWABA - U.S. President Donald Trump confirmed that USS Abraham Lincoln was sent toward Iran, amid rising tension between Washington and Tehran and accusations that Iran has resumed working on its nuclear program despite last year's attacks by the U.S. "We have a lot of ships going that direction, just in case … I’d rather not see anything happen, but we’re watching them very closely," Trump told reporters aboard Air ...
